Perfect balance

This car is the perfect balance between sportiness and everyday practicality. I get thumbs up almost everywhere I go with this car. It's stylish, economical, and has many safety features. Mine has ABS, front and side air bags, and traction control. The 4.0 6 cylinder has plenty of horsepower and torque and the insurance and gas cost is much cheaper than the 8 cylinder GT. I was a Camaro fan for many years but this car has converted me to Ford. I love the retro look, including the 5 spoke wheels. Also, the aftermarket parts available for these cars is both plentiful and affordable.

2007 Mustang in good repair

This model of the Mustang is on the retro styling introduced with the 2005 model. Frankly, I like it better than the 2010+ model years' appearance, but that's purely a personal thing. V6 model has plenty of power for day to day driving without killing your wallet at the gas pump. You aren't going to get 30mpg in town, but for a Mustang to get 22mpg, that's still better than average. The car does control the transmission in according to how you are driving. Stomp the gas and you will go through the gears at a higher RPM. A more sedate start will cycle the gears quickly as well, but at lower RPMs to keep the mileage up. The car is holding up well and I would not be surprised to push it well past 200k before it is retired.

**GAS VALVE ISSUE - NO RECALL**

Do yourself a favor and if you are looking at an 06 or 07 Mustang go to the gas station and see if it TAKES fuel! We bought our son a car and were RIPPED OFF because it passed inspections, but when we went to fill up the pump acts like it's full and we literally have to pump in 10 cents at a time. No fix and no Ford recall. BUNCHA BS. DON'T BUY if you don't have 40 minutes to spare every time you fill up.

2007 GT500 and KBB pricing

This is truely an amazing vehicle. I absolutely love it!However, the promotion of inflated prices is shameful at best! It is my opinion that some are manipulating numbers to influence the market? The real market numbers aren't even close! I have been actively watching sales and price points of 2007 GT500's for the last two years. If a dealer were paying the trade-in price listed they would go out of business. The open market sale of most of these cars is below the listed trade-in price. 2011's are now listing for the $41k. This is a great car for the money, but look at the market before you take a $10,000 bath!
